The EXR Faculty and Staff are proud to announce our 2025–26 EXR Programmatic Award and Honor Students! Congratulations to these outstanding students for their hard work, dedication, and achievements throughout their time in the Exercise Science program.
Carlos Pineda: Undergraduate Marshal – Exercise Science. Chatham, IL
-- Carlos is recognized as the 2026 Undergraduate Marshal for the Exercise Science program for his strong academic performance, dedication to healthcare, research experiences, and service to the community. Carlos plans to attend physical therapy school and pursue a career specializing in neurologic physical therapy.
Lillian Buzani: Outstanding EXR Student – Health & Fitness Track. Carol Stream, IL
-- Lillian is honored as the Outstanding Exercise Science Student in the Health & Fitness Track for her academic dedication, athletic accomplishments as a student-athlete, leadership, and extensive hands-on experiences through coaching and internships. Lillian plans to pursue a master’s degree in Athletic Training and hopes to positively impact future athletes and underserved communities.
Reagan Martyn: Outstanding EXR Student – Physical/Occupational Therapy Track. Rochester, IL
-- Reagan is recognized as the Outstanding Exercise Science Student in the Physical/Occupational Therapy Track for her academic excellence, involvement in the Exercise Science Organization, and commitment to service. Reagan will begin Bradley University’s Doctor of Physical Therapy program in May 2026.
